**Mgmt Meeting Minutes — Retiring the Brightline Range**

Quick recap for sales leads at Fenholt Supplies: we agreed to retire the Brightline fixture range by year-end. Remaining stock moves to clearance pricing next month, and accounts on standing orders get migrated to the Lumetta range. Trade-in incentives were approved in principle. The confidential note on next steps sits just below.

board note of bajof-bajeg: The pricing group signed off on a budget of $13.4 million for Project Sildor. The renewal with Lamixek Holdings closes at $48.9 million a year, 49 percent above the last contract.

ALERT: Quotaforge per-tenant limit breach

Tenant traffic on the Brindlemoor edge tier exceeded its assigned rate quota by 14x over a ten-minute window. Quotaforge throttling engaged late because the limit cache had gone stale after a config push. No cross-tenant impact observed, but the stale-cache path could allow sustained overuse before enforcement. Cache TTL reduced pending a permanent fix. Incident timeline and enforcement logs are available on the internal page here.

operations page: https://kibana.sivrelcloud.corp/browse/spaces/spaces/issue/16dd39fa3e3f990c

// Retention sweeper batch ceiling for the Hollowpine archive service.
// The sweeper deletes expired records in batches of this size; larger
// values starve the primary's vacuum cycle, smaller ones let backlog
// grow past the 30-day SLA. This was tuned against production load in
// the Marlow cluster — do not bump it without a load test. Reviewers
// should verify any change against the sweep run identified by the
// token recorded below.

pipeline stamp: htk3_69f

Subject: Weather-alert fan-out changes in Stormcast 3.2

Hello plugin authors,

Stormcast 3.2 changes how weather alerts fan out to subscribers. Alerts are now batched per region before delivery, so plugins receiving per-user callbacks will instead get one regional payload with a recipient list. Update your handlers before the cutover next month; the legacy path will be removed. Test against the staging fan-out service. The staging build you should target carries the token below.

build token for kagaf-hahof: htk14_9d3d4d26d7d8de